3. On speed - Shifter is fast out of the box. Most speed improvements are made by tweaking plugins and your wordpress/setup. Plugins can kill the speed of your blog way faster than a theme can bog you down. I took a look at your site and it's loading pretty fast. But I did notice you don't have a far future expires date for some of your elements, particularly your images. Stocking stuff away in a visitors cache save lots of load time and is a great place to start when you're trying to speed up your site.</description>
